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26583 2660415607 9854230
4576 2642 59844027680
4576 2642 59844027680
0017490 332718226 6379 30 011582
All about undefined
Interested in learning more?
4576 2642 59844027680
0017490 332718226 6379 30 011582
See more
9774698 81623
646309329 404 68081497
See more
7507 333057
71 59027 7858940650
See more